Program overview

Main Subject

Education and Training

Study Level

Masters

The Interdisciplinary Early Childhood Education (IECE) Master of Education program prepares its graduates to consume, critique, produce, and apply research as a foundation to their leadership within their chosen professions. If an applicant already holds teacher certification in IECE, the graduate degree program leads to Rank II IECE certification in Kentucky. The Master of Education program does not lead to initial IECE certification. Students who want IECE certification, but have certification in another area or do not have any teacher certification, should first complete the graduate initial certification program in IECE, which leads to Rank III IECE certification. Students entering the IECE Master’s program decide to either take the thesis (30 credit hours) or non-thesis (36 credit hours) option.
